本文主要記錄下在使用selenium2/webdriver時啟動各種瀏覽器的方法、以及如何加載插件、定制瀏覽器信息(設置profile)等 環境搭建可參考我的另一篇文章:http://www.cnblogs.com/puresoul/p/3483055.html 一、Driver下載地址 ...
本文是對上一節的補充:http: www.cnblogs.com puresoul p .html 使用Selenium webdriver 啟動firefox且自動加載firebug插件時,切換到firebug插件的網絡和cookies部分時,提示面板已被禁用,如下圖所示: 於是我們輸入about:config在firefox設置頁面試着去找下是否有什么參數控制着面板的禁用 啟用,果然被我找到如 ...
2015-02-02 11:29 0 5966 推薦指數:
本文主要記錄下在使用selenium2/webdriver時啟動各種瀏覽器的方法、以及如何加載插件、定制瀏覽器信息(設置profile)等 環境搭建可參考我的另一篇文章:http://www.cnblogs.com/puresoul/p/3483055.html 一、Driver下載地址 ...
本文主要記錄下在使用selenium2/webdriver時啟動各種瀏覽器的方法、以及如何加載插件、定制瀏覽器信息(設置profile)等 環境搭建可參考我的另一篇文章:http://www.cnblogs.com/puresoul/p/3483055.html 一、Driver下載地址 ...
selenium 參數設置 selenium啟動chrome基本上與真實環境類似,但有一些變量還是不一樣,需要注意。 有些網站通過這些參數識別爬蟲。 window.navigator.webdriver 值為undefined是正常的瀏覽器,返回true說明用的是Selenium模擬 ...
首先這次使用的webDriver for Firefox的 由於項目的原因,需要在測試的時候加載Firebug和使用vpn,加載代理 Firefox 加載代理,可以從FF菜單上看,代理分為好幾種 我這里使用的是type 為2 的情況 如果type 為1 ,需要這么設置 ...
元素定位的重要性不言而喻,如果定位不到元素談何操作元素呢,webdrvier提供了很多種元素定位方法,如ID,Name,xpath,css,tagname等。 例如需要定位如下元素: <i ...
WebDriver提供了常用的WEB控件的操作方法,比如:按鈕、輸入框、超鏈接等,廢話不多說,直接上代碼: /**操作 上傳控件upload * 1.一般是把路他徑直接sendKeys到這個輸入框中 * 2.如果輸入框被加了readonly屬性,不能輸入 ...
1.1 下載selenium2.0的包 官方download包地址:http://code.google.com/p/selenium/downloads/list 官方User Guide: http://seleniumhq.org/docs/ 官方API ...
用System.setProperty方法設置webdriver.firefox.bin的值 import org.j ...